What’s the difference between an ATV and a UTV?

ATV stands for “all-terrain vehicle.” Typically, an ATV is used for recreation. Designed for single riders, the most common ATVs are four-wheelers/quads. A UTV is a “utility task vehicle.” Designed with a cabin for two to four riders, a UTV is used for work or recreation. Alternative UTV names are SxS and side-by-side.

What three items should be in the on position when starting up an ATV?

Turn on the fuel valve. Make sure that the engine stop switch is in the “run” or “on” position. Put the choke in the “on” position if the engine is cold. Start the engine.

Are side-by-sides safer than quads?

Safety. If you have safety at the top of mind, then a SxS/UTV is what you want. Compared to an ATV’s open design, side-by-side vehicles are more closed with a barrier. SxS/UTV are also commonly known to have features like a roll cage, seat belts and windscreen that protect riders and passengers from the elements.

Why are ATVs better than UTVs?

An ATV is the more maneuverable vehicle compared to a UTV, as ATVs are able to handle tight turns and dense timber or brush with ease. Also, narrow off-road trails may only be open to ATVs (and motorcycles/dirt bikes), though some restricted routes can accommodate 50-inch SxS UTVs.

Is driving a UTV like driving a car?

A UTV does not handle like a car. UTVs have aggressive off-road tires, high ground clearance, and a narrow wheelbase. The general rule to follow when driving through this rough terrain is to have one foot on the gas and the other on the brake.

Which is safer UTV or ATV?

But utility vehicles also come with unique design features, making them safer than all-terrain vehicles. First, UTVs offer a lower center of gravity thanks to their payloads being positioned below the top of the tires.

Are UTV good in snow?

The answer of course is yes. The most common uses for an ATV or UTV in cold weather would be for work—plowing a driveway or hauling wood for your fire. And when well-equipped with proper tires or tracks, that same ride can get you across your property’s acreage even when the way isn’t plowed.
